In the digital age, access to high-quality medical services is no longer limited by space or time. Understanding the community’s increasingly refined healthcare needs, FV Hospital is officially launching the FV@HOME application. This is a comprehensive digital healthcare solution that brings doctors and patients closer together through a simple smartphone.

Connect with Specialist Doctors Anytime, Anywhere
The greatest challenges of traditional medical visits are travel time and long waiting periods. With FV@HOME, users can engage in video-based health consultations (telemedicine) directly with FV’s highly qualified medical specialists.
Whether you are at the office, at home or away on a business trip, connecting with a doctor for an initial consultation or follow-up has never been easier. This feature is particularly useful for non-urgent health concerns and general health advice, providing greater peace of mind by ensuring that medical experts are always within reach.
A Complete Healthcare Ecosystem for the Entire Family
FV@HOME is more than just an appointment-booking application – it serves as a capable healthcare assistant for the whole family. With a single account, users can manage health records for themselves and their relatives, including children and the elderly, through the “Add Family Member” feature.
All information — including teleconsultation records, electronic prescriptions and, where applicable, medical reports — is securely and transparently stored within the application. The platform also serves as an authoritative medical resource, providing regularly updated clinical articles that allow users to access reliable health information and stay informed about the latest treatment techniques available at FV.

FV@HOME also serves as an authoritative information portal, providing regularly updated clinical and medical articles.
A Stepping Stone Towards “Hospital at Home” Services
At present, FV@HOME focuses on optimising the telemedicine experience to ensure maximum stability and convenience for users. However, this is only the beginning of FV’s broader digital transformation.
In its upcoming development phase, FV@HOME will expand to include “Healthcare at Home” services. Patients will soon be able to book nurses, physiotherapists, midwives, care assistants or doctors to visit their homes and perform various medical procedures such as wound care, sample collection, post-operative care, mother-and-newborn care, elderly care, and more. This marks a significant breakthrough, bringing international-standard home healthcare even closer to the community.
